What does Michael Buffer get paid to say let's get ready to rumble?

How much does Michael Buffer make to say "Let's get ready to rumble"? Depending on the match, Buffer earns between $25,000 and $100,000 every time he utters those five famous words. On a handful of extremely rare occasions, Buffer has been paid $1 million.

How much does Michael Buffer make saying let's get ready to rumble?

It says that he makes between $25,000 and $100,000 per fight, though occasionally he has made up to $1 million. The majority of his career earnings have actually come from a trademark on his catchphrase.

Why does Michael Buffer not say let's get ready to rumble?

But the younger Buffer was actually the one involved in trademarking Michael's signature saying in 1992 shortly after becoming his manager. The Voice of the Octagon told BT Sport: “I realised (Michael) hadn't trademarked [Let's get ready to rumble'] and had no t-shirts or hats.

Who owns the rights to Let's Get Ready to Rumble?

The trademark, issued in 1995, lists the word mark “Let's get ready to rumble” as a protected phrase owned by Ready to Rumble LLC.

Is Bruce Buffer Michael Buffer's brother?

Buffer's catchphrase is "It's time!", which he announces before the main event of the UFC. He is the half brother of the boxing and professional wrestling ring announcer Michael Buffer, and is the President and CEO of their company, The Buffer Partnership.

Who made let's get ready to rumble famous?

The greatest thing famed boxing announcer Michael Buffer ever did was come up with the catchphrase "Let's get ready to rumble!" The smartest thing he ever did was copyright it. Since 1992, the year Buffer secured the trademark for his signature catchphrase, he's raked in over $400 million from its use.
